ReconAfrica Provides Year-End Operational Update Progressing Projects in Namibia, Angola and Gabon

RECO · Price
Executive Summary
- ReconAfrica reported significant hydrocarbon indications from its second well (Kavango West 1X) in Namibia’s Damara Fold Belt and announced a production test slated for Q1 2026.
- The company signed an Angola MOU granting access to 5.2 million acres and a Gabon offshore Production Sharing Contract, expanding its asset portfolio.
- Detailed well‑log data show ~85 m of net reservoir in the Huttenberg formation and strong gas/oil shows in the deeper Elandshoek interval, supporting further development plans.
Key Details
- Kavango West 1X Well Results – Wireline logging identified ~85 m (280 ft) of net reservoir with 64 m (210 ft) of net hydrocarbon pay in the Huttenberg formation; deeper Elandshoek interval (~560 m) exhibited ~20% total gas and visible oil sheens. Hydrocarbon fluorescence increased to 81 m (265 ft).
- Production Test Plan – Decision to forego a DST and proceed directly to a multi‑zone production test covering up to eight reservoir intervals; testing equipment being sourced internationally, with operations expected to start Q1 2026 for 4–8 weeks.
- Operator Interests – ReconAfrica holds 70% working interest in PEL 73 (Kavango West), partners BW Energy (20%) and NAMCOR (10% carried).
- Angola MOU – Signed April 2025 with ANPG for joint exploration in the Etosha‑Okavango basin; adds 5.2 million contiguous acres to existing 6.3 million acres in Namibia. Geochemical sampling of surface seeps to begin Q1 2026.
- Gabon Offshore Ngulu PSC – Signed September 2025 with Gabon Oil Company; ReconAfrica operates with 55% working interest, partners Record Resources (20%), GOC (15%) and Republic of Gabon (10% carried). 3D seismic data to be received Dec 2025, reprocessing Jan 2026, followed by third‑party resource report.
- Future Milestones – Production test on Kavango West 1X expected Q1 2026; Angola surface sampling and Gabon seismic reprocessing also slated for early 2026.
